cb-625 Serial Interface

The Serial Interface connects the cb-625 to a standard PC serial port. The interface costs £8.95 but for those of you who can't wait or have an electrical bent this is what you will get built into a DB-25 plug housing.

If you really want to go it yourself you need to know:
The cb-625 interface sends at 9600 baud, 8 databits, 1 stop bit, no parity.
The RTS line must be set active (+ve) and the transmit data left inactive (-ve)
The data consists of a 4 digit ascii decimal number, zero filled with the most significant digit first followed by a carriage return (0DH) and a line feed (0AH)
This is the number of clock cycles at 4MHz taken for the pellet to travel the 60mm gap between the two sensors.
